Digital Normal. India Skills Report 2021 Emphasises certain kinds of “digital excellence”. The Report reveals that during the period of 2015 to 2021, “employability” of BE/BTECH, MCA and MBA have gradually declined while that of BA Arts and Polytechnic have increased Similarly, hiring trends have also undergone distinct changes where IT based business services and banking and other financial services dominate the other sectors. Underscores the dynamic nature of skill requirement and mere supply of skill may not automatically and necessarily create the demand for themselves.
